.html A few days ago Rory posted the first five or so pages of Pierre Boulle's
Planet of the Men Script which contained a scene about Taylor and Nova
discovering a tribe of humans and Taylor swearing to help man rise again. I
am going to move the story along for those who are interested (but not type
the whole script).
The next scene takes place four years later. Zaius and Maximus are concerned
about chimpanzees that are demonstrating about the imprisonment of Zira and
Cornelius. Lucius is leading the demonstration. Zaius blames Taylor for the
whole thing. Eventually the gorilla police break up the proceedings. Maximus
comments on their loyalty, Zaius on their stupidity.
Eventually Zaius has Cornelius and Zira brought to him. He hopes to convince
them not to publicly admit that their errors, just to keep quiet about what
they know about man. Cornelius and Zira refuse. Zaius then reveals that his
spies have learned of several large bands of humans in the Forbidden Zone.
Zaius ordered a raid, in hopes that Taylor will be killed in the process.
The next scene is a flashback of the raid. The gorilla beaters make a
tremendous noise as they raid the humans (only with clubs, no firearms).
Taylor is seen successfully ordering the men around and getting them to
behave in an orderly fasion. Taylor stops them and threatens them with a
rifle and even shoots one of the gorillas in the arm. Nova is seen carrying a
baby. The gorilla's retreat and tell their leader that "The-man-who-talks" is
there.
Cut back to Zaius' office. Zira and Cornelius are grateful that the raid was
unsuccessful, but Zaius asks how Zira is going to continue her medical
experiments if men cannot be captured. Zira just shrugs. Zaius then shows
them another report.
Cut to another flashback of Taylor, Nova, young Sirius (their son) and other
men around a fire. Nova and Sirius speak.
Cut back to Zaius's office again. As they finish reading the report Zaius
appeals to the chimps about the possible consequences of this disturbing
information. Cornelius and Zira are speechless. Zaius frees them both.
The next scene takes place ten years later....but we'll get to that
later......

Hey Gang,
I don't know why I
haven't mentioned this book before, but I'm doing so now.
It's "The
Studio" by John Gregory Dunne. It was published in 1968 and here's
what's said about it at Amazon.com where it sells for only $11.20.
"In 1967, John Gregory Dunne asked for unlimited access to the inner
workings of Twenteith Century Fox. Meraculously, he got it.
For one year Dunne went everywhere there was to go and talked to
everyone worth talking to within the studio. He tracked every step
of the creation of pictures like "Dr. Dolittle," "Planet of the Apes," and
"The Boston Strangler." The result is a work of reportage that,
thirty years later, may still be our most minutely observed and therefore
most uproariously funny portrait of the motion picture business.
"Whether he is recounting a showdown between Fox's studio head and two
suave shark-like agents, watching a producer's girlfriend steal a silver
plate from a restaurant, or shielding his eyes against the glare of a
Hollywood premiere where the guests include a chimp in a white tie and
tails, Dunne captures his subject in all its showmanship, savvy,
vulgarity, and hype.
"'Reads as racily as a novel...(Dunne) has a
novelist's ear for speech and eye for revealing detail...Anyone who has
tiptoed along those corridors of power is bound to say Dunne's
impressionism rings true.'-- Los Angeles Times"
Here's an excerpt
about "Planet of the Apes"....
"That afternoon, Richard Zanuck watched
the previous day's rushes of 'Planet of the Apes.' The scene showed
an ape doctor giving a blood transfusion. The recipient was
Charlton Heston, the donor Linda Harrison, who played Nova, the mute Earth
Girl. In angle after angle, the ape fastened the tube between the
arms of the two Earth people.
"'You don't give a transfusion that
way,' Owen McLean said in the darkness of the projection room. 'You
take blood out of one arm first, then pump it into the other arm.
You can't make blod flow from arm to arm like that.'
"'He's
right, Dick,' Stan Hough said.
"Zanuck was unperturbed. 'What
the hell,' he said. 'Maybe that's how an ape does it.'"

Hey, it's Mr. Krueger. I
xeroxed the "Apes" contents pages of the Jacobs archives at Loyola Maramount
University. I will now list what they have. Remember these were Arthur's, as
donated by Natalie Trundy (and I think she deserves a round of applause for
having this stuff preserved). The archives, found in Los Angeles are open to the
public, but only for serious research. Since there's so much, I will give each
film an e-mail. This one is the stuff for the original
film:
Box 54
Legal; Trade Ads; Production Budget;
Reviews; Legal; Presentation;Shooting Script;Screenplay;1st Draft Screenplay,
5/25/64; 2nd Draft, 12/23/64; Notes on Production and Story Treatment; 2nd Notes
on Production and Story Treatment, 10/25/63; 2nd Draft Screenplay, 12/17/64;
"Cinefantastique" ("Apes" issue, of course); Magazines; Notes on Production and
Story Treatment
Box 55
Pierre Boulle Notes, 4/29/65; Screenplay
by Michael Wilson; General Correspondence; Triple Release Date; French Reviews;
General; Clippings; Preliminary Production Information Guide (3); Movie Folders;
Picture
Box 56
Revised Screenplay; Final Draft
Screenplay; Screenplay; Revised Screenplay; 2nd Revised Screenplay; Notes on
Production and Treatment; Presentation 1, 10/25/63;
Test Sequence; Revised Screenplay; 2nd
Draft, 12/23/64; Foreign Article; 20th Century Fox 1967 Annual
Report
Box 57
Academy Campaign, 1968; Magazines;
Publicity Campaign; Ads; Foreigh Clips; English or Foreign Magazines; English
Clippings; Trades; APJ: Personal; Preview Reports; Clippings; A Guide and
Commentary for Teachers and Students; Script; Poster;
Award

.html .htmlHi Everybody,
While I try to get over the terrible trick played on me by a certain person
who said there'd be a new POTA trailer on TV tonight, I thought I'd share
with you all parts of an interview I found with the late, great Franklin J.
Schaffner.
I haven't seen many interviews with him on the subject of PLANET. The best
was probably the one in Cinefantastique, and that didn't say much. Then one
day in a used bookstore I found a collection of old 'Films in Review'
magazines. On the cover of one for Aug.-Sept. 1969, beneath a picture of
Catherine Deneuve, was written "A Colloquy with F. J. Schaffner." I looked
inside. What I found was an interview with Schaffner done by somebody named
Stanely Lloyd Kaufman Jr., a Yale undergraduate. The interview was conducted
by phone and taped. Here's some of the more interesting things Schaffner had
to say about PLANET in what I think is the best interview with him that I've
read.
Kaufman: There were many long shots in PLANET. Were they merely to give
hints of Earth?
Schaffner: Well, in southern Utah and northern Arizonia there are areas and
plateaus where you see for 20 miles and 360 degrees. Also, there won't be a
telephone pole, nor a person, nor a road -- nothing. It's overwhelming, and
it absorbs you, and you can think of nothing but how the camera can get it on
film. It seemed appropriate to me to set the astronauts up for horizon lines
on Panavision, and to represent them as very, very small in relation to the
planet on which they were. First of all, they had lost their spaceship, they
were cut off from everything. Second, these long shots impressed the locale
on the audience, not the personalities of the astronauts. There was another
problem with this picture. Its got this lousy title of 'Planet of the Apes,'
and from the very beginning audiences expect to see an ape. But for thirty
minutes they don't. Therefore, it is obligatory to keep those first thirty
minutes going while you set up the story. That required a combination of
things, both in scripting and in directing. We hoped that at the end of the
thirty minutes the audience would be surprised when the apes appeared.
Kaufman: The crash-down opening sequence in PLANET seemed much more
terrifying than anything in other films of the genre, like 2001, for instance.
Schaffner: Right. A body of water was chosen for the space-ship to land in
because the craft had been programmed to land on a solid surface. When the
space-ship went out of control the astronauts had a chance of survival if it
crashed into water. Obviously, until we got into the lake we didn't want to
wake the astronauts up because we didn't want anybody to start reading tapes
or playing back tapes, to find an answer to why they were where they were,
and so forth. The crash itself, of course, is very definately the bridge
between the men in the rocket going to sleep and waking up in the locale of
the ape society. One thing the crashdown did do, it seemed to me, was to
provide a dramatic coming out of the titles. The prologue for PLANET was
very quiet, and as we came out of the titles we had to get the story going.
To get the aerial shots for the crash-down the cameraman was on top of a
World War I biplane. We also had a B-25 with a camera in its nose. But when
I ran their footage for the crash-down it simply didn't seem to work. So I
said the hell with it, let's shoot the picture and then we'll come back to
this thing. When we finished shooting and I sat down to cut the picture
there was one can of film I had never seen and by cutting wide-footage into
zoomed-lens stuff and mixing things up and reversing footage, literally
reversing footage, and even running some footage backwards, we put together a
sequence which seems to work pretty well for the crash. But it was not
planned at all. What was planned didn't get on the screen. What is up there
on the screen is what was edited together out of desperation.
Kaufman: PLANET has been criticized for being an inconsistent mixture of
social satire and sci-fi seriousness.
Schaffner: There are a number of ways to approach a project of this kind.
You can make it into the blackest comedy imaginable; you can do a straight,
realistic science-fiction piece; horror science-fiction; or straight
melodrama. The situation was exotic enough for anything. But our
over-riding intention was to make, for lack of a better word, a mass
entertainment film. I'm not one who says anything entertaining isn't art. I
think the most successful art has elements that entertain. That is why
PLANET is not all-out satire, why it is not all-out "gallows' humor," why
humor, and melodrama, are mixed with the satire.
Kaufman: Should I assume you're not really interested in the science-fiction
aspect of this film?
Schaffner: Yes. I always winced when somebody called it a science-fiction
piece.
To be continued....
